M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
researches
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
improvements in
blended learning have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
e-learning organizations
are dealing with
in 2015 because e-lear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can institutions
make sure that
the quality of instruction provided by these
MOOC courses is
good?
How can organizations
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ach courses online?
What different business models are being used by
institutions like
Peter I Island to conduct these MOOCs?
What experimental assessment str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can educators
handle problems like
inadequate
motivation and high
learner attrition?
